How do I Stop my kitten from chewing on teeth?

Avoid brushing his teeth during this time; you don’t want to teach him that brushing hurts. Feed him a soft food that doesn’t make him chew or crunch, and consider buying a teething ring made especially for kittens.

Is cat grass safe for kittens teething?

However, make sure you are growing (or buying) cat grass specifically — not all plants and grasses are safe for kittens or cats teething. In addition to providing appropriate chew toys, help keep your kitten comfortable while she is teething by feeding soft food.

How do I choose the best teething kitten toys?

There are many chew toys to consider for your teething kitten. When selecting a toy, make sure it is not something she can swallow or choke on. Avoid hard toys as these might damage her teeth. Some toys are designed to be chilled in the refrigerator or freezer to provide relief for your kitten’s sore gums.

Is it OK for kittens to play with toys when teething?

As kittens are teething, their mouth can become painful and uncomfortable. Be considerate about it, and do not encourage your kitten to play roughly with the toys being in her mouth. Do not pull hard on toys and stop any play if you notice that it hurts her.

How often do cats need dental cleanings?

Studies show that up to 67 percent of cats may be affected by tooth resorption during their lifetime, most notably during middle age. Routine professional dental cleanings under anesthesia (COHATs), in combination with daily oral home, can help minimize dental disease.

Can I give my kitten grass to eat?

As an alternative, you can freeze a wet wash cloth and give it to your kitten. Your kitten also may enjoy chewing on grass in a pot. Select a grass that is safe for cats, such as barley, oats, rye, wheat or a combination. You can purchase grass or seeds to grow your own at many pet supply stores.

What to do when a kitten is teething and drooling?

3) Eat less. Kibble and dry kitten food is often too hard and hurts your teething kitten’s gums, so you may notice they eat less. 4) Whine, drool. Just like human babies, kittens may whine from the pain or drool more. The best way to care for teething kittens is to provide them with soft, wet food and soft chew toys.

How long does kitten teething last?

The good news is your cats teething won’t last. Your kitten will begin teething at approximately 3 1/2 to 4 months of age. Teething continues until all of her adult teeth have grown in at approximately 6 or 7 months of age and should end by 8 months to a year old. Adult cats have 30 permanent teeth.
